为何会出现app外链其他app?
在用户使用app的过程中,可能出现需要使用到其他app中的内容或功能的情况。为了方便用户快速跳转到其他app,很多app会提供外链的功能。
什么是app外链?
app外链是指在一个app中,用户可以通过点击链接或按钮,跳转到另一个app中的指定页面或功能。
外链app是否安全?
外链其他app时需要注意,要确保跳转到的app是安全的。因为有些恶意app可能会冒充其他常用app,误导用户安装,以达到恶意行为的目的。因此在跳转前,应该先进行确认可以跳转到的是正确的应用。
如何避免恶意外链?
可以通过下载信誉良好的应用商店,在其平台上下载和安装app,或试图通过搜索引擎或其他官方渠道下载。安装之后,可以通过第三方安全软件或官方安全软件对 app 进行全面扫描,以确保 app 安全性,防止被恶意程序盗取密码、窃取信息等。
什么情况下需要使用app外链?
你可以通过外链,来帮助现有用户快速跳转到其他应用中的一个特定页面或帮助用户通过端内代码,找回丢失的端数据;还可以快速向用户传达App新特性。
app外链还有哪些作用?
除了提升用户体验,app外链还可以帮助开发者进行推广。通过与其他热门app合作,可以让更多的人知道你的app,增加品牌曝光率及用户的留存率。
如何实现app外链?
通过应用跳转实现,我们可以将应用与外部应用程序连接起来,使其成为其他应用的一部分。比较常见的方式包括 uri schema 方案和定制协议方案。而在android最早期版本因为兼容本地系统api,开发者最上手的跳转策略就是选用浏览器跳转scheme 方案, 如下:
<intent-filter>
<action android:name=\"android.intent.action.VIEW\" />
<category android:name=\"android.intent.category.DEFAULT\" />
<category android:name=\"android.intent.category.BROWSABLE\" />
<data android:scheme=\"baichuanexample\" />
</intent-filter>
记得在“AndroidManifest.xml” 文件的 application 标签中添加如上 intent-filter 节点,在个算一个网页浏览器时重定向到本应用。 同时使用WebApi作为数据接口做Android”一站式”开发。